Q: Is 1,407,396 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,407,396 is a composite number.

Why is 1,407,396 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,407,396 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 17 34 51 68 102 204 6,899 13,798 20,697 27,596 41,394 82,788 117,283 234,566 351,849 469,132 703,698 and 1,407,396, with no remainder.

Since 1,407,396 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,407,396, it is a composite number.
